Chicago Mailman Sings To Grandma Who Lost Her Husband — Receives An Unexpected Blessing

A mail delivery in Chicago recently turned into a moment that touched millions.

Lavonte Harvey, a mail carrier known on his route for singing as he works, had no idea that one heartfelt gesture would change his life. In doorbell camera footage that’s now been viewed around the world, Harvey walks up to a home and says warmly, “This is for you, Grandma,” before launching into a song.
The performance was meant to brighten the day of a grandmother who had recently lost her husband of 50 years. The song lifted her spirits so much that she shared the video with her granddaughter, Whitney Cumbo — and Cumbo decided to post it online.
She added a touching caption over the video:
“My grandmother lost her husband of 50 years, and the mail man is her daily dose of life. You are appreciated.”
Within two weeks of being posted, the clip racked up millions of views and over 10,000 comments. What started as a simple act of kindness quickly became a viral sensation.
“I didn’t expect for it to go viral,” Harvey said, explaining that singing is something he regularly does along his route. For him, it’s about much more than music.
“For me, singing isn’t just music,” he said. “It’s about ministry, it’s about spreading hope and joy.”
During an appearance on Good Morning America, Harvey thanked Cumbo and her family for sharing the video and supporting him after the attention poured in. The family even helped launch an online fundraiser that allowed him to purchase a new car.

“I love you guys so much. It’s because of you so many doors have been open for me that I’ve only dreamed of,” Harvey said during the interview. “There are not enough thank-you’s in this world that I can honestly say or give you guys. Just know that you have my heart, and I will always be here.”
Since the video went viral, Harvey says he’s stayed in regular contact with the family — and that his life has been transformed by a moment that began with a simple goal: to lift someone’s spirits.
